We’re back with a full episode! We’ve gone less with the analytics and more with the tactics this week, taking a closer look at the origin and evolution of some of the tactical set-ups that have shaped the game.
 
How was Pep Guardiola influenced by the Hungarian national team? Is 'parking the bus' the same as Catenaccio? Is the long ball method statistically the best way to score a goal? In Episode 13, we look at tactics old and new, weighing in on how the game has changed over the years!

The Football Fanalytics Podcast is the show where two football fans, Ryan Bailey (Senior Podcast Producer at Crowd Network) and Mark Carey (Data Analyst at The Athletic), combine their love of the game with their knowledge of football statistics and data analytics. Join us as we break down some of football’s key concepts, explore the ever-growing world of football analytics, and get the views from a whole host of guests across the game. With access to the Twenty3 Content Toolbox, we will also bring you up-to-date analytics on players and teams across the continent. But this is not just about the numbers, we will be looking at all of the above from the fan’s point of view.
